Hisar, 31 December (HP)
The 6th Elite Men’s National Boxing Championship began on Saturday at Giri Center of Haryana Agricultural University. Urban Local Bodies Minister Dr. Kamal Gupta inaugurated the championship on Saturday. Minister Dr. Kamal Gupta and HAU Vice-Chancellor Dr. BR Kamboj met the boxers and encouraged them. During this, President of Haryana Boxing Association, Major Satyapal Sindhu was also present. Dr. Kamal Gupta said on the occasion that sports are very important for the all-round development of the youth. It is closely related to physical, mental, psychological and intellectual health. Sports give us motivation, courage, discipline and concentration. The central and state governments have started many schemes and unique programs to take the players forward.
500 boxers from 36 teams taking part:On this occasion, Ravindra Panu, General Secretary of the Boxing Association said that more than 500 boxers from 36 teams across the country are participating in the National Boxing Championship which will continue till January 6. In the championship, boxers who have participated in many international events including Commonwealth Games and Asian Championships will show their skills. The winners of this championship will play either in the Boxer India Camp or directly in the Commonwealth or Asian Championships.
